Why the installer matters as high as the panels
Most house owners start with product inquiries. Which panel is finest? Is one inverter brand name far better than an additional? Should I add a battery currently or later?
Those are reasonable questions, but they come after the larger issue: system style and implementation. A premium panel set up on the wrong roof covering plane or coupled with sloppy electrical wiring is not a costs system. On the various other hand, a mid to top tier panel with sound format job, correct setbacks, precise shielding analysis, and a receptive solution team commonly executes precisely as it ought to for years.
Solar is not a single purchase. It is a sequence of choices. Website assessment, format, financing, contract language, permits, setup, inspection, PTO from the energy, and future service all impact the final worth. The installer touches every step.
That is why the most inexpensive quote is not constantly the least pricey alternative in technique. A reduced quote can hide weak assumptions about yearly manufacturing, impractical scheduling, or thin post-install support. If a firm goes away, farms out everything without oversight, or drags out modification job, the savings disappear quickly.

What a trustworthy proposition looks like
A great proposition really feels particular. It needs to reflect your home, your electric usage, and your objectives. If it reviews like a common layout with your address pasted in, that is a caution sign.
At a minimum, the proposition should discuss how many panels are being mounted, where they are going, what tools is consisted of, what estimated manufacturing resembles, and what presumptions drive the financial savings forecast. If there is financing, the installer ought to separate system rate from financing price so you can see what you are actually spending for the tools and labor.
The much better propositions also resolve what takes place if conditions alter. As an example, if the roof decking demands fixing after panel removal locations are revealed, that deals with that? If the major circuit box requires upgrades to support solar, is that consisted of or noted as an allowance? If a battery is not consisted of currently, can the system suit one later without major redesign?
A proposition worth relying on usually seems a little much less fancy and a little much more concrete. That is an excellent thing.
Questions that reveal whether an installer recognizes their craft
When evaluating solar installers near me, a short conversation can inform you greater than an expensive sales brochure. You are not just listening for the answers. You are listening for how the answers are framed. Experienced specialists tend to discuss trade-offs clearly. Sales-driven firms often pivot away from specifics and back towards regular monthly repayment talk.
Use concerns like these throughout your estimate process:
- How did you compute production for my roof, and what shielding assumptions did you use?
- Who does the installation job, your team or subcontractors, and that supervises high quality control?
- What guarantees cover tools, workmanship, and roof covering infiltrations, and that handles service claims?
- What additional electrical or roofing expenses typically show up on homes like mine?
- How long does allowing, installation, examination, and energy approval usually take in Danville?
None of these inquiries are aggressive. They are standard due persistance. The appropriate installer will invite them. In fact, solid business commonly address most of them prior to you ask.

Price matters, however pricing framework issues more
Homeowners not surprisingly focus on the total contract cost. They should. Solar is a significant acquisition. Still, raw price alone can be misleading.
Two systems with comparable panel matters might differ due to the fact that one includes a main panel upgrade, attic room conduit runs, animal guard, keeping track of arrangement, and stronger craftsmanship coverage. An additional might look less expensive because essential items are omitted or due to the fact that the financing framework spreads out costs in a way that hides the genuine system price.
Cash acquisitions, finances, leases, and power purchase arrangements all alter just how value should be judged. A reduced regular monthly repayment can be accomplished by prolonging term length or embedding costs into financing. That does deficient a bad option for every homeowner, yet it does indicate you need to compare equivalent numbers.
A beneficial way to evaluate propositions is to ask each business to provide the money rate, financing terms, estimated first-year production, and what is consisted of in creating. As soon as those numbers get on the table, contrasts come to be far more honest.
Roof condition is not a side issue
If your roofing system is near completion of its life, solar may need to wait. I understand home owners do not enjoy hearing that, specifically after spending time on price quotes, however removing and reinstalling a solar array later is costly and disruptive.
A responsible installer will not rush past this point. They will examine roofing age, product, and noticeable problem. On asphalt shingle roof coverings, if you are within several years of replacement, it deserves talking about roof covering initially. On ceramic tile roof coverings, the conversation might shift towards underlayment problem, fragility, and the skill of staffs functioning around floor tile. On complex roofing systems with numerous infiltrations, flashing high quality ends up being much more important.
This is where count on turns up again. Good installers agree to shed a sale today to prevent a poor project tomorrow. That honesty has a tendency to save house owners money.
Batteries deserve going over, not assuming
Storage has actually ended up being a much larger part of the solar conversation, and for good reason. Some homeowners want backup power for outages. Others desire more control over exactly how they utilize solar power, especially if utility rate structures make self-consumption more valuable.
Still, a battery is not automatically the best add-on. It raises task expense dramatically, and not every family needs full-home back-up. Occasionally a partial backup method covering refrigeration, net, some lights, and a couple of circuits is the far better fit. Often property owners choose solar now and leave the system battery-ready for later.
An excellent installer need to walk you with actual use situations. If your main issue is keeping clinical devices, garage gain access to, and food refrigeration online throughout blackouts, that is a various battery layout than attempting to run air conditioning for extended periods. System sizing ought to follow your requirements, not the other way around.

Warranties sound excellent until you require service
Solar warranty language is typically misinterpreted. Devices warranties typically originate from the supplier. Craftsmanship guarantees originate from the installer. Roofing system infiltration warranties might be independently mentioned. Those differences issue since the procedure for getting assistance relies on who is responsible.
Ask who you call initially if result declines all of a sudden. Ask what solution reaction appears like. Ask whether labor for warranty replacements is covered. Ask exactly how surveillance notifies are dealt with, and whether somebody is actually reviewing them or if the burden drops entirely on you.
The dry run is simple: if an inverter stops working six years from currently, will you know specifically who to call, and do you believe they will still exist? Solid local firms often win on this point, also if they are not the most inexpensive quote. Reliability after setup has actual value.

Local allowing and utility sychronisation can make or break the timeline
Many home owners assume installment day is the main event. It is very important, but it is just one step. A job can move quickly on the roof and then being in a line for examination or utility approval. That is frustrating if nobody described the procedure upfront.
Competent installers set assumptions early. They will typically define the sequence in plain language: style finalization, permit submission, installation organizing, metropolitan inspection, energy approval, and permission to operate. They might not have the ability to ensure precise days, since some actions depend on agencies outside their control, yet they ought to be able to define the likely rhythm of the job.
That kind of interaction is particularly vital if you are intending around traveling, roofing replacement, re-finance timing, or a major household job. The difference between a three-week delay and a three-month surprise typically comes down to exactly how aggressive the installer is.

Do solar panels work in winter in Danville?
Yes, solar panels continue producing electricity during winter whenever sunlight is available. Shorter days and cloud cover usually reduce total energy production compared to summer. Cold temperatures can improve panel efficiency under clear conditions. Keeping panels free of debris helps maintain performance.
